About Gabriel Krigsfeld

Gabriel Krigsfeld is a scholar working on Radiology, Nuclear Medicine and Imaging, Pulmonary and Respiratory Medicine and Physiology, having authored 19 papers that have together received 692 indexed citations. Recurring topics across this work include Effects of Radiation Exposure (12 papers), Spaceflight effects on biology (6 papers) and Radiation Therapy and Dosimetry (6 papers). The work is most often cited by research in Radiology, Nuclear Medicine and Imaging (174 citations), Cancer Research (88 citations) and Oncology (159 citations). Gabriel Krigsfeld has collaborated with scholars based in United States, Norway and Japan. Frequent co-authors include Ann R. Kennedy, Patrick A. Mayes, David T. Dicker, Gen Sheng Wu, Wafik S. El‐Deiry, Jenine K. Sanzari, Wenge Wang, Joshua E. Allen, Luv Patel and Akshal Patel. Their work appears in journals such as PLoS ONE, Cancer Research and International Journal of Radiation Oncology*Biology*Physics.
